It looks like we won't be seeing much of Prince William and Prince Harry in the upcoming Diana.

According to the Daily Mail, there is only one "significant scene" of the duo interacting with their mother, Princess Diana, in the biopic.

In the scene, Princess Diana reportedly hugs the boys, played by Laurence Belcher (William) and Harry Holland (Harry), leads them to a helicopter bound for Balmoral and tells them she'll see them in five weeks. 

This ends up being the last time she sees them.

Director Oliver Hirschbiegel told the site that additional scenes featuring the princes were cut out because "it never felt right to have them in the film."

"Everyone knew she was a brilliant mother and loved her boys to death," Hirschbiegel continued.

The film centers the life of Princess Diana (Naomi Watts) and her love story with heart surgeon Dr. Hasnat Khan (Naveen Andrews).

The film is set to be released in the U.K. Sept. 20. A release date for the U.S. hasn't been issued yet.
